Review Manufacturing Process Information

The Manufacturing Process pane shows the processes required to manufacture the component being analyzed:

You can expand each step to view more details for each operation.

  • Use the Edit and View options to examine and modify information in more detail - see Menu Options.

  • Click the Primary Process Group button to edit the Primary Process group in the Cost Object Infowindow - see Using the Cost Object Info window.

    (Other components require both primary and secondary process groups, for example, Casting and Machining. See Add Secondary Processes.)

  • Click the Material button to launch the Material Selection window - see View and Edit a Material.

  • Click the command button next to the Material button to display the details of the currently selected material.

Status Indicators

The Status column shows the costing status of each operation:

  • Green: Costing completed successfully.

  • Yellow: Costing succeeded with a warning. Typically, a warning means that the requested operation could not be used costing but costing succeeded with an alternative operation.

  • Red: Costing failed.
